What is Rosuvastatin?

Rosuvastatin is a potent statin that is commonly prescribed to manage hyperlipidemia and decrease cardiovascular risks. By inhibiting HMG-CoA reductase, an enzyme involved in cholesterol production in the liver, it effectively reduces low-density lipoprotein (LDL) cholesterol levels.
